Elvis has left the bidding
Costello shows to croon as VAG auction defies market swoon

The all-white décor of the Vancouver Art Gallery auction suggested a wedding set, and as one gallerist exclaimed, it was exhilarating to be among so many wealthy people passionate about art. Sipping pre-dinner champagne, guests included Jost Baaker and wife Marlee Ross. Thanks to gala co-director Claudia Beck (spectacular in brilliant green heels) the auction catalogues were impressive, and in defiance of crashing stock markets, bidding often exceeded suggested prices by thousands of dollars. David Aisenstat, newly appointed chair of the VAG Board, snagged Elvis Costello as the promised secret celebrity, but organizers fretted until three days before the party waiting for confirmation. ... A few weeks later at the VAG, an installation and performance by internationally renowned artist Kai Althoff saw guests crowded into a stuffy top-floor room. Politicians Larry Campbell and Peter Manning and artists Jeff Wall, Angela Grossman and Attila Richard Lukacs watched Althoff in whiteface beat a drum and bob and sway among people doing calisthenics.

For her recent show Roman Holiday at the Bau-Xi Gallery, Val Nelson decided “to let her brush lead.” The result: a visual banquet of impressionistic brushwork, renaissance subject matter and the incongruity of 21st-century scaffolding cropping up in every canvas. Upstairs, Marcus Bowcott’s land- and seascapes, with their flat planes and cool colours, offered a quiet, meditative contrast to Nelson’s lavish works. The portraits of women and children, by Chinese artist Xue Mo at the Diane Farris Gallery, also evoked the renaissance with their distant landscapes and mid-canvas horizons.

More paintings at the Jeffrey Boone Gallery, where Jeff Depner presented a series of colourful geometrics in Reconfigured Grids. ... The VAG exhibition WACK! has spawned other feminist-themed exhibitions including a collection of historical printed material by and about local women artists at Artspeak Gallery. On the opening afternoon, gallery director/curator Melanie O’Brian chatted with Marianne Penner Bancroft, whose own show was on at the Republic Gallery, and her ECAID colleague, Randy Lee Cutler.
